4G chip provider, Beceem has launched a sixth-generation
WiMAX chip.
The imaginatively titled BCSx350 chip uses “Twin-Turbo”
dual transmit uplink technology and can provide up to 6dB of performance gain
compared to traditional Wave 2 uplink technology. The outfit claims that it is the most advanced 4G-WiMAX
platform ever designed.
It will come in two models. There is the BCSM350 for
mobile/embedded devices and the BCS5350 for high-performance, low-cost CPE that
simultaneously support data, voice, and WiFi in a single chip.
It is expected to go into mass production Q2/2010 and
there is no word on price yet.
